Transaction 16311cea0a19c419f36e314c89d11d765066ae2b68ad697c32c53203efa12f7d
1 Input
1 Output
-
16311cea0a19c419f36e314c89d11d765066ae2b68ad697c32c53203efa12f7d:0
- value
- 1452565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c805939a21186189292ca7bd4e32af2caa9175cb OP_EQUAL
- address
- 3KvdkNoeuZverSTKX1yB5XxohbRa9LhYjm